Purpose: Oversee the activity of the quality assurance department and staff, developing, implementing, and maintaining a system of quality and reliability testing for the organization's products and/or development processes.

Key Area of Responsibilities:

  • Responsible for manufacturing quality assurance including incoming quality, in-process quality, semi-finished product quality, and outgoing product quality.
  • Lead a team of inspectors and supervisors to ensure incoming materials met internal and customer specifications and requirements.
  • Drive incoming quality assurance process improvement in efficiency and effectiveness
  • Owner of Non-Conformities and Error Management Systems. Collaborate with Headquarters for any system upgrade or changes
  • Responsible for non-conforming materials disposition and Material Review Board (MRB)/ Corrective Action Board (CAB) and drive robust corrective and preventive actions
  • Drive robust manufacturing system and process quality to meet internal and customer requirements and expectations
  • Perform analysis on non-conforming quality incidents and internal errors and provide recommendations to meet internal and customer requirements and expectations
  • Support Customer Quality to investigate customer product complaints
  • Be responsible for manufacturing quality KPIs and reporting to senior management
  • Lead a team of engineers to drive NPI and First Article quality requirements and system
  • Provide leadership and consulting advice in quality matters
  • Plan and lead manufacturing process audit
  • Lead, train, develop, and coach Quality team members. Manage performance evaluation and strengthen the organization.

Qualification & Experiences:

  • Bachelor in Engineering (Mechanical, Electrical, Electronics, Chemical) or Material Science.
  • 8 years of experience in Quality Assurance function, at least 3 years as a quality manager/leader in the manufacturing environment.
  • Strong knowledge and practice in 8D, SPC, MSA, FMEA, QFD, 6-sigma methodology, PPAP, change management.
  • Experienced QMS (ISO9001, IATF16949) auditor will be added advantage
  • Good understanding of First Article Inspection requirements and expectations
  • Strong in statistical knowledge and 6-sigma methodology. Certified Black Belt or Green Belt preferred.
  • Strategic, creative and systemic thinking
  • Excellent leadership and effective communicator with all levels of associates and management.
